Output f80765c80ee7a862a010c25d42ede67d6ae9c26551d23f0699dfd1f8ab9c577e:17

value
5516
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 670e9284873c35ac3bd27912b54712ff3b2cac6fcf0ef83c2ffa02879274dd9e
address
bc1pvu8f9py88s66cw7j0yft23cjluajetr0eu80s0p0lgpg0yn5mk0qtjakj5
transaction
f80765c80ee7a862a010c25d42ede67d6ae9c26551d23f0699dfd1f8ab9c577e
confirmations
128659
spent
true